Transaction f74a73b9343b3d7df24b72c714b92ea3aa9a25f807682d439dca660b95ab6664
1 Input
2 Outputs
- f74a73b9343b3d7df24b72c714b92ea3aa9a25f807682d439dca660b95ab6664:0
- f74a73b9343b3d7df24b72c714b92ea3aa9a25f807682d439dca660b95ab6664:1
value 900000
address 1AZBUGDoT2rCbo8gWdUUP38CKsUPmeWyKA
value 1877769
address 39cqy15y1MmyoR73HrVqxX2h5GqquwD16Q